Harnessing Gains Through Intraday Trades

Intraday trading can be a action-packed way to potentially accumulate profits. It involves buying and selling financial instruments within the same market day, aiming to profit from short-term price.

To maximize your chances of success, it's crucial to develop a solid trading and diligently adhere to risk management principles.

A successful intraday trader typically possesses several key traits: strong analytical skills, the ability to instantly process information, and exceptional discipline.

They constantly monitor market trends, news events, and technical indicators to spot profitable positions.

Moreover,Implementing a well-defined trading plan that outlines entry and exit points, profit targets, and stop-loss orders is essential.

This plan should also cover risk management strategies to control potential losses.

Intraday trading can be intensely rewarding, but it's not without risks.

It requirescommitment, continuous learning, and a willingness to adapt to ever-changing market conditions.
